Outlaws outlast the SWAT

Jun 1, 2019 | 10:12 PM

The Prince Albert Outlaws evened up their record to 3-3 in the Prairie Gold Lacrosse League senior ranks, with a 13-10 victory over the Saskatoon SWAT (3-2).

The Outlaws win also exacts revenge for their latest defeat, a 15-9 SWAT victory in Saskatoon on May 24.

Outlaws attacker Brennan Boruch scored a hat trick while Brody Holizki had two goals and four assists in the victory.
